Delta Publisher, Felida blames Isoko leaders for insecurity in their domains
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terShare on LinkedinShare on Whatsapp

The Chief Executive Officer of Fone-Media Integrated Company, Publishers of Isoko Mirror, Comrade Felida Essi on Saturday said Isoko community leaders are the cause of the insecurity in their domains.

Comrade Essi spoke with Our Correspondent during the 15th anniversary, lectures & awards ceremony of the newspaper which held at the Isoko Development Union, IDU Hall in Oleh, Isoko South Local Government Area of Delta State.

According to her, “The problem first of all is caused by the Community leaders. They sold and hired our lands to the herdsmen and that brings about insecurity.

“Of course, once the herdsmen come in, they want to take over. That’s part of the major problem and it’s caused by our leaders.

She also urged the leaders to shun the peanuts they make from the herdsmen to help safeguard the lives and property of their citizens.

Comrade Felida also enjoined the people to be hardworking and not to pursue politics alone but to go into farming.

According to her, “There is money in farming.”

Meanwhile, the publisher of Isoko Mirror Newspaper has said politicians wanted his medium to be a “Political Paper”.

Comrade Essi said, “But we refused. For that, they don’t patronize us.”

She said development has made it hard for the medium to hold its programmes in Isoko soil but in Warri.

The publisher disclosed that some politicians called some persons not to attend the 15th Anniversary/Lectures & Awards ceremony of the Newspaper in Oleh, Isoko South Local Government Area of Delta State today Saturday, December 5.

She said the reason is,” Because we are not a political paper” just as she pointed out that the media establishment had always held its events in Warri.
